Why use Browser Sources?īrowser Sources make it possible to use web-based content as sources in your scenes instead of capturing them with a Window Capture source. Since this kind of content is usually not written in the same coding languages as your streaming application, a translator is needed to make it possible for both to communicate with each other.

What are Browser Sources?īrowser Sources can be added to your scenes of your streaming software and enable you to use web based content such as Flash and JavaScript applications, websites and so on and even customize them via css. This URL requires using a Browser Source in your broadcasting software. If you use a donation or subscription alert system like TwitchAlerts, or maybe you are using BraneBot‘s polling system, chances are you’ve been given a long URL that you’re expected to plug in somewhere in order for it to display on your stream.
